Suddenly lacking power
When accelerating from a stop, I can’t even get the front end off the ground. There’s a lack of power, but once I’m going, the power seems to be there until it hits 45 mph, then it completely cuts out. I have no power at all above 45 mph, but between 5-45 mph it seems to have tons of power.
Only thing I can think of is I washed my funnel out before I used it to fill the oil, but I wiped it dry with a rag. There may have been a handful of water droplets left in the funnel, but it was 99% dry. I just can’t imagine such a tiny amount of water affecting it. The oil on the dipstick looks good too, not milky and not too thin.
Could that be the issue, or is it likely something else? Any ideas?
Wierdest problem – goes in reverse over 6000rpm
I am new to the forum and am hoping you could help me with a wierd problem.
I have a 2008 (most possibly made in 2007) 800 model max xt efi 4×4.
When my rpm goes over 6000, somethimes the cpu thinks its in reverse and stops the trottle or the power. It’s like it cut’s my throttle for a quick sec. I can see the R in the display, so the cpu is maby acting right, but what is the orgin of this? When I have over 7000 rpm it constantly cuts rythmicly. So lying with full thottle on the freeway is impossible because of the atv cut’s power frequently.
I had a theory about the sensors on the tranny, but I have tighten those, and watched that there was no vibrational difference from 5000 to 7000, yet the power is constant without "cut’s" on 5000.
I think it’s something inside the engine that is wrong.
I have a "maintenance soon" error message followed by "High Tor Mulen". Tryed googling it but, nothing. I also tried getting out error codes (p-codes) but there werent any.
I might at some point overfilled with oil. Because the other day a lot of oil were gone without any lekage.
I also may have damaged the bearings in the cranck case while I was trying to get the clutch out without a clutch puller.
I also fully had apart the tranny and changed some bearings after runnig it dry and half totaled the tranny. The tranny is now working very good, and I can’t understand how rpm controlled cut’s can have anything to do with the tranny. It gotta be something inside the engine that is wrong…
Any Ideas? I’m out on my deapth here x)

Rear diff oil grey and muddy coloured
Thing One: I changed my diff oil myself for the first time and the rear was grey coloured with the occasional strand of black in it. I’ll put a picture up. The front was green and looked like new so I’m wondering if there’s a leak in the back and it’s filling with crud. My dealers closed or I’d call them but I’m wondering if anyone with a bad seal ever had the same looking fluid when they drained it.
Thing Two: I grabbed the wrong bottle off the bench and put 75w 90 in the gearbox instead of 140. Can I run at least a while or should I drain it and put the 140 in. That drain bolt is a BITCH.
